The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Muenster cheese and Extra Creamy Whipped Topping side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
Muenster cheese is the more energy-dense option here, packing 81 more calories per 100g than Extra Creamy Whipped Topping.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
In terms of sugar control, Muenster cheese takes the lead with only 0g of sugar per 100g, whereas Extra Creamy Whipped Topping contains 20g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
Looking to build muscle? Muenster cheese offers a protein boost with 23.8g per 100g, outperforming Extra Creamy Whipped Topping in this category.
